Advertisements How do you smoke Kippers? Add oak bisquettes to the Bradley Smoker stack and set it to smoke at a temperature of 75°C/170°F and the top vent open. Place the racks of herring and roes into the cabinet and smoke for 2 – 3 hours.

WebKippers will last up to two weeks if stored properly in the refrigerator. You can also freeze them for up to three months. Choosing the best kippers: Look for bright orange or pink ones. They should also be free of any dark …

WebDec 12, 2024 · Kippers are actually whole herrings that are gutted and sliced in half from the head to the tail. The fish is salted or pickled before being cold-smoked.
